The overview below groups typical Plumbing Line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Peoria,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Repairs - Minor plumbing line repairs typically cost between $150 and $400,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, fixing a small leak or replacing a section of pipe may fall within this range.
Pipe Replacement - Full or partial replacement of plumbing lines can range from $1,000 to $3,500. Costs vary based on pipe material, length needed, and accessibility in the property.
Leak Detection - Detecting hidden leaks usually costs between $200 and $600. The price depends on the complexity of locating the leak and the tools required.
Emergency Repairs - Urgent plumbing line repairs can range from $300 to over $2,000, especially if immediate work is needed outside regular hours or involves extensive damage. Costs depend on the severity and scope of the repair need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that plumbing lines need repair? Signs include persistent leaks, low water pressure, strange noises, or foul odors coming from drains, indicating potential issues with plumbing lines.
How long does plumbing line rep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
Are plumbing line repairs disruptive to household activities? Some repairs may cause minimal disruption, such as temporary water shut-offs, but experienced contractors aim to complete work efficiently to reduce inconvenience.
What causes plumbing lines to fail or leak? Common causes include corrosion, tree root intrusion, shifting soil, or aging pipes, which can lead to leaks or blockages requiring repair.
How can I prevent future plumbing line issues? Regular inspections by local pros, avoiding chemical drain cleaners, and addressing minor issues promptly can help maintain plumbing system integrity.
